The Iconic Romance Of Guy Ritchie And Madonna A Deep Dive Into Their Relationship

The whirlwind romance and ultimately, the dissolution, of filmmaker Guy Ritchie and pop icon Madonna remains a captivating chapter in celebrity history. Their union, a vibrant blend of British grit and American pop extravagance, captivated the world's attention for years, leaving behind a legacy that continues to fascinate. This article delves into the details of their relationship, exploring its highs and lows and analyzing its lasting impact.

A Match Made (and Unmade) in Hollywood

Their meeting in 1998 wasn't a chance encounter; it was a carefully orchestrated introduction. Madonna, already a global superstar, found herself drawn to Ritchie's edgy, stylish filmmaking, particularly his debut Lock, Stock and Two Smoking Barrels. Theirs was a relationship that transcended typical Hollywood pairings. Ritchie, grounded and relatively private, provided a counterpoint to Madonna's flamboyant public persona. Their contrasting personalities fueled both their initial attraction and, ultimately, their eventual separation.

A Royal Wedding and a Growing Family

Their wedding in December 2000 was a lavish affair, a spectacle worthy of the couple's combined fame. Held in a stunning Scottish castle, the ceremony solidified their status as one of Hollywood's most talked-about couples. Their family expanded with the arrival of Rocco Ritchie, their first child together, in 2000. This addition further cemented their seemingly solid union, presenting a picture of domestic bliss often showcased in glossy magazines and paparazzi photos. Madonna's adoption of David Banda in 2006, though occurring later in their marriage, further shaped their family dynamics.

The Cracks in the Foundation

Despite the outward appearances of a successful partnership, cracks began to appear in their relationship. Madonna's relentless career and globe-trotting lifestyle clashed with Ritchie's preference for a quieter, more domestic existence. Reports of increasing disagreements and irreconcilable differences surfaced, painting a less-than-rosy picture behind the glamorous façade.

A Difficult Divorce

Their divorce in 2008 was finalized after a lengthy and highly publicized legal battle. The complexities of their shared assets and custody arrangements dominated headlines, highlighting the challenges of disentangling such a high-profile union. The details of their separation, including custody battles, served to underscore the realities of their irreconcilable differences, dispelling any lingering images of a fairytale ending.
